Gods of Jade and Shadow by Silvia Moreno-Garcia
The Mayan god of death sends a young woman on a harrowing, life-changing journey in this dark, one-of-a-kind fairy tale inspired by Mexican folklore.
Lore of the Wilds by Analeigh Sbrana
A stunning Romantasy debut about an enchanted library, two handsome Fae, and one human who brings them all together.
Siren Queen by Nghi Vo
Set in a 1930s Hollywood filled with magic and danger, this magical-realism novel offers up an enthralling exploration of an outsider achieving stardom on her own terms, in a fantastical Hollywood where the monsters are real and the magic of the silver screen illuminates every page.
Spellbreaker by Charlie N. Holmberg
In Victorian England, Elsie Camden was born able to break spells. But as an unlicensed magic user, her gift is a crime. When elite magic user Bacchus Kelsey discovers her secret, they strike a deal to work together, but as their bond grows, so does the danger.
The Cat Who Saved Books by Sosuke Natsukawa
The world is full of lonely books, left unread and unloved, and only Tiger (a talking cat) and Rintaro can liberate them from their neglectful owners. And so, the odd pair begin their journey to set books free.
The House in the Cerulean Sea by TJ Klune
A government caseworker is sent to a mysterious orphanage where magical children live. It's a heartwarming story that explores love, acceptance, and the magic of found families.
The Rage of Dragons by Evan Winter
In this epic fantasy, a world trapped in eternal war hinges on the fate of Tau, a man whose quest for revenge could determine the survival of his people.
The Scandalous Confessions of Lydia Bennet, Witch by Melinda Taub
A magical retelling of Pride and Prejudice from Lydia's perspective. Filled with wit, romance, and unexpected redemption, this novel reimagines the wildest Bennet sister's journey with a touch of magic.
Witch King by Martha Wells
The demon king Kai, imprisoned after being murdered, wakes to find a lesser mage attempting to harness his magic for personal gain. As Kai seeks answers to his imprisonment and the changes in the world since his assassination, he must use all his dark powers to uncover the unsettling truth.
A Fate Inked in Blood by Danielle L. Jensen
In this Norse-inspired fantasy romance, a shieldmaiden blessed by the gods battles to unite a nation under a power-hungry king—while fighting her growing desire for his fiery son and facing perilous tests set by the gods.
